Workdays and Weekends 

Planning to use your truck for work? We’ve got just the thing for you: the new 2024 GMC Sierra 2500 HD. The Sierra 2500 Crew Cab has a best-in-class maximum towing capability of up to 22,070 pounds.* The available 6.6-liter Duramax turbo diesel V8 engine is capable of up to 975 pound-feet of torque, so if you’re pulling a trailer that’s fully loaded, your truck won’t have any trouble providing the get-up-and-go you need.

*Class is gasoline and diesel heavy-duty pickups in the GM Large Pickup segment. Based on latest competitive data available. Sierra’s 22,070-lb max rating requires a properly equipped Crew Cab long bed 2WD model with available 6.6L Duramax Turbo Diesel V8 engine, Trailer Brake Controller, Max Trailering package, Gooseneck/Fifth-Wheel Prep Package 18″ or 20″ wheels and tires and gooseneck/fifth-wheel hitch. Maximum trailering ratings are intended for comparison purposes only. Before you buy a vehicle or use it for trailering, carefully review the trailering section of the Owner’s Manual. The trailering capacity of your specific vehicle may vary. The weight of passengers, cargo and options or accessories may reduce the amount you can trailer.
